Description: 
At 301 PM CDT, Doppler radar was tracking strong thunderstorms along a line extending from near Bucklin to 9 miles northeast of Keytesville to near Salisbury. Movement was northeast at 35 mph. H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 50 mph.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around unsecured objects. Locations impacted include... Bucklin, Ethel, Wien, Callao, New Cambria, Elmer, Prairie Hill, Salisbury, Bevier, and Keytesville.
Instruction: 
If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building. A Tornado Watch remains in effect until 700 PM CDT for north central Missouri.
